Caricatures - Wanna guess who these celebrities are?


I have been practicing on caricature drawing since obtaining a position for a masquerade ball two weeks ago. The ball won't take place until Oct. 29, but I want to establish a cohesive balance of speed and formality with each drawing, as well as play with the subjects distinct facial features.





When I have time, I wish to draw within a frame of 5-10 minutes, just to see if I can get the job done in a relatively quick manner since there are going to be plenty of attendees at the masquerade ball. Thus far, I am pleased with the current results, but I still have plenty of work to do. Wish me luck!
